Minimum requirements for all
Trailblazers will include:
- Anyone over 18.
- Basic computer skills, including knowledge of Microsoft Word
and Excel.
- Good written and verbal English skills.
- Experience of working within a team environment.
- Commitment to volunteer one day a week.
- Eligibility to work as a volunteer within the UK in accordance
with immigration rules.
What will the volunteers be
doing?
Volunteers on the Trailblazer programme will
undertake a variety of roles, including:
- Data entry support.
- Administration support to functional areas.
- Helping with the organisation of activities and events such as
forums, seminars, meetings and conferences.
- Undertaking other duties appropriate to the role and needs of
LOCOG.
